2+ years as data engineer, software engineer, or data analyst. Battery Engineering / Electrical Engineering experience desired
Working knowledge and experience with big data
Strong working knowledge of Python, SQL, and Git. Basic knowledge of SQL databases, Spark, data warehousing, and shell scripting
Candidate must have solid competency in statistics and the ability to provide value-added analysis
Self-starter with entrepreneurial experience and ability to interact with other functions in matrix environment. Proven creativity to go beyond current tools to deliver best solution to the problem
Familiarity with database modeling and data warehousing principles
Experience in designing and building data models to improve accessibility, efficiency, and quality of data. Improve ELT efficiency and answering business critical questions with data
Experience building scalable data pipelines using Spark, etc. is a plus
Desirable for experience with Apple OS, such as iOS, MacOS, etc
Job Description:
Write ELT pipelines in SQL and Python. Utilize advanced technologies, for modeling enhancements
Test pipeline and transformations, and document data pipelines
Maintain data and software traceability through GitHub
Build a high-quality data transformation framework, implementing and operating data pipelines with an understanding of data and Client lifecycles
Understand end to end nature of data lifecycles to deliver high quality data and debug data concerns
Drive development of data products in collaboration with data scientists and analysts. Automate reporting where possible to make team more efficient
Be able to analyze factory, user, and failure data and use engineering understanding mechanisms to resolve battery problems
Work with diverse teams including data scientists, engineers, product managers and executives
Deliver high quality analytic insights from a data warehouse
Provide ad-hoc reporting as necessary (sometimes urgent escalation)
Write programs for data filtering, organization, reporting. Write programs for uploading to and maintaining data in SQL database. Develop basic data management and selection programs on SQL
ANY GRADUATE